Sample UPMSP High School Gujarati Practice Questions

Try these sample questions to review concepts for the UPMSP High School Gujarati exam. Each question includes a detailed explanation. Start the interactive quiz above for the full 100+ question experience with AI tutoring.

1Read: "સવારે વરસાદ પડ્યો, છતાં શાળાની ઘંટડી સમયસર વાગી." What is the main idea?
A.Despite morning rain, the school bell still rang on time.
B.School was cancelled because of rain.
C.The bell was broken all week.
D.Students never attend school in the monsoon.
Explanation: The connective છતાં (despite/yet) contrasts rain with the bell ringing on time, so the main idea is continuity of school timing despite rain.
2Read: "રામેશ પુસ્તકાલયમાં બે કલાક બેઠો અને નોંધો લીધી." Which detail is explicitly supported?
A.Ramesh skipped school all week.
B.Ramesh sat in the library for two hours and took notes.
C.The library was closed for repairs.
D.He returned every book he owned.
Explanation: The sentence states location (library), duration (two hours), and action (took notes).
3Read: "મા બીમાર હતી, તેથી સીતાએ ઘરનું કામ પૂરું કર્યું." What cause–effect relation is shown?
A.Sita caused her mother to fall ill.
B.Housework caused the mother to recover instantly.
C.Mother’s illness caused Sita to finish the housework.
D.No cause is stated at all.
Explanation: તેથી marks result: mother’s illness → Sita completed the work.
4Read: "બાળકોએ વૃક્ષો વાવ્યા અને પાણી પણ આપ્યું." What best restates the idea?
A.The children cut down every tree.
B.Only adults planted trees.
C.No watering is mentioned.
D.The children planted trees and also watered them.
Explanation: વાવ્યા (planted) and પાણી આપ્યું (gave water) are coordinated actions by the children.
5Read: "પરીક્ષા નજીક છે, છતાં કેટલાક વિદ્યાર્થીઓ હજુ તૈયારી શરૂ કરતા નથી." What tone does the sentence carry?
A.Concern or mild criticism about delayed preparation
B.Celebration of a festival only
C.A pure weather report
D.A math formula definition
Explanation: Contrast between approaching exam and lack of preparation implies concern/criticism.
6Read: "ગામડાના લોકો નદી કિનારે એકત્ર થયા અને પૂરથી બચવાના ઉપાય વિશે વાત કરી." What is the central purpose of the gathering?
A.To plan a wedding only
B.To discuss ways to stay safe from the flood
C.To cancel the river forever
D.To sell exam papers
Explanation: They gathered and talked about measures (ઉપાય) to escape/survive the flood (પૂર).
7Read: "તેણે વચન આપ્યું હતું, પરંતુ સમયસર પહોંચ્યો નહીં." Which inference is most reasonable?
A.He arrived earlier than promised.
B.He never made any promise.
C.He failed to keep his promise about arriving on time.
D.Timekeeping is irrelevant to the text.
Explanation: પરંતુ contrasts the promise with not arriving on time—broken time-related commitment.
8In comprehension, what should you do first when an unseen Gujarati passage seems long?
A.Ignore the passage and guess randomly
B.Translate only the last word
C.Count letters instead of reading meaning
D.Skim for topic sentences and question keywords, then reread carefully
Explanation: Skimming for structure and keywords, then careful reading, is efficient exam strategy for unseen passages.
9Read: "શિક્ષકે કહ્યું કે નિયમિત અભ્યાસથી ભય ઘટે છે." What claim does the teacher make?
A.Regular study reduces fear.
B.Fear increases only with more study.
C.Study is useless for exams.
D.Rules ban all practice.
Explanation: નિયમિત અભ્યાસ (regular practice/study) is linked to reduced fear (ભય ઘટે છે).
10Read: "પહેલા આકાશ સાફ હતું; પછી વાદળો ઘેરાયાં અને વરસાદ શરૂ થયો." What organizational pattern is used?
A.Alphabetical dictionary listing
B.Chronological sequence of weather change
C.Only a pure definition with no events
D.A multiplication table
Explanation: પહેલા… પછી marks time order: clear sky → clouds → rain.

About the UPMSP High School Gujarati Exam

The Uttar Pradesh UPMSP High School (Class 10) Gujarati examination (subject code 903) is conducted by Uttar Pradesh Madhyamik Shiksha Parishad (UPMSP), Prayagraj. Official Board Syllabus pages on upmsp.edu.in list Class 9/10 PDFs for code 903. High School candidates offer six subjects under the published subject-combination rules (five compulsory + one optional). Common full-marks pattern is Theory 70 + Internal/Practical/Project 30 = 100 with approximately 3 hours 15 minutes for the theory paper (confirm the subject PDF). Official assessment language is Gujarati. English MCQ study adaptation with Gujarati terms when integral. Focus: Gujarati reading, grammar, literature, and writing craft. Time Limit

3 hours 15 minutes (typical UPMSP High School theory paper; confirm current scheme for the subject)

Passing Score

Minimum 33% marks in the subject (commonly 33/100 combined theory + internal/practical as applicable); for theory+internal schemes, school sources often cite minimum 23/70 theory and 10/30 internal — confirm current UPMSP regulations/circulars.

Exam / Certification Fees

As per UPMSP High School examination fee notification for school (institutional) and private candidates for the current examination year on upmsp.edu.in / prereg.upmsp.edu.in — confirm the latest circular; subject papers are not separately priced on this page. Class 9/11 advance registration fee of INR 50 per student is a separate pre-registration charge, not the High School exam form fee.
